Output dfc974c228b59167f7f3c416c8d7ee1cf60f8000df44751da38d22dd73a3f5d1:330

value
13246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c905734bb4289d40aacd786bb1d340315b826cd OP_EQUAL
address
37DFP1ycqRcNc3ohfUm6uVN3tr7wr742r7
transaction
dfc974c228b59167f7f3c416c8d7ee1cf60f8000df44751da38d22dd73a3f5d1
confirmations
538121
spent
true